Python环境下APP自动化测试配置指南
需积分: 7 140 浏览量
更新于2024-09-08
3
收藏 592KB DOCX 举报
本文将详细介绍如何搭建Python APP自动化测试环境,包括所需的软件下载、安装步骤以及环境配置,确保能够进行有效的自动化测试。
在进行APP自动化测试环境搭建时,首先需要安装必要的软件工具。以下是一步步的详细步骤:
1. Node.js 安装
- 访问 [Node.js](https://nodejs.org/en/) 官方网站,下载最新版本10.12.0。
- 将安装包安装到D盘ProgramFiles目录下。
- 安装完成后,通过运行 `npm --version` 命令来验证npm是否已成功安装。
2. Appium Doctor 安装
- 使用npm全局安装Appium Doctor:`npm install -g appium-doctor`。
- 安装完毕后,运行 `appium-doctor test` 检查服务器环境是否满足Appium测试的需求。
3. JDK下载与环境变量配置
- 前往 [Oracle JDK](https://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html) 下载页面,下载适用于你系统的JDK。
- 安装JDK后,设置系统环境变量:
- 新建系统环境变量JAVA_HOME,值为JDK的安装目录(例如:D:\ProgramFiles\Java\jdk1.8.0_181)。
- 在Path变量中添加JDK的bin目录(例如:D:\ProgramFiles\Java\jdk1.8.0_181\bin)。
4. Android SDK下载与安装
- 访问 [Android Studio](https://developer.android.google.cn/studio/#downloads) 下载页面,下载并安装Android Studio。
- 在D:\ProgramFiles\tools\bin目录下打开命令行,输入 `sdkmanager.bat --list > packagelist.txt` 列出所有可用的SDK组件。
- 需要安装的组件主要是`Build-tools`和`platforms`,选择合适的版本进行安装。例如,你可以通过以下命令安装多个Build-tools版本:
```
sdkmanager.bat "build-tools;19.1.0" "build-tools;20.0.0" "build-tools;21.1.2" ...
```
- 确保安装了相应的Android平台版本,这对于支持不同版本的Android应用是必要的。
完成以上步骤后,你的Python APP自动化测试环境基本搭建完毕。接下来,你可能还需要安装Python、Appium库、相关测试框架(如Selenium或Appium-Python-Client),以及可能的模拟器或真机驱动。记得在Python环境中配置好Appium的路径,并根据你的测试需求编写自动化测试脚本。在整个过程中,确保所有环境变量正确配置,以便各个组件能够正常工作。
在实际操作中,可能还会遇到一些依赖问题,如adb、证书配置等,需要根据具体情况解决。保持耐心,细心处理每个环节,你就能成功搭建一个稳定可靠的APP自动化测试环境。
2019-03-15 上传
2022-12-01 上传
2019-05-03 上传
2022-11-12 上传
2022-07-15 上传
2019-12-20 上传
2022-08-08 上传